Punjabi Inspirational proverbs

Punjabi inspirational proverbs are known for imparting wisdom and positivity, often reflecting the rich cultural heritage of Punjab. These sayings encourage resilience and hard work, with famous examples like "Manukhta sab ton vaddi sewa hai," which means "Humanity is the greatest service." Remembering these proverbs can provide motivation in daily life, while simultaneously boosting your understanding of Punjabi culture.

      Punjabi Inspirational Proverbs

      Punjabi culture is rich with inspiration and wisdom, often communicated through proverbs. These sayings encapsulate the values and philosophy of the Punjabi people. Exploring Punjabi inspirational proverbs can offer valuable insights into this vibrant culture. Below are some popular proverbs and their meanings.

      Understanding Punjabi Proverbs

      Punjabi proverbs serve as a guiding light, offering wisdom through simple yet powerful phrases. They address various aspects of life, making them relevant to different situations:

      • Kare kama prabh ka laba ki dhikhi nahi. - This means that one should keep working and not focus on the results.
      • Admi apni chal bhedhda ha. - Translates to 'A man's actions reveal his character.'

      Cultural Significance of Proverbs

      Punjabi proverbs carry cultural significance as they reflect the collective experiences and wisdom of generations. They are often:

      • Used in daily conversations to convey messages succinctly.
      • Passed down orally through generations, preserving linguistic heritage.
      • Reflective of the agricultural lifestyle of Punjab.
      Understanding these proverbs allows you to peek into Punjabi traditions and values.

      Punjabi proverbs not only provide guidance but also reflect the humor and wit inherent in Punjabi culture. They often use metaphors related to farming and livestock, given Punjab's agrarian roots. Such proverbs create a picturesque representation of the society, binding people through shared linguistic and cultural expressions.

      Proverbs for Personal Growth

      In Punjabi, inspirational proverbs are often used to encourage personal growth and resilience. They offer advice on overcoming challenges and maintaining integrity:

      • Mainat rang laando hai. - Hard work pays off.
      • Parai aag vich khoonda nahi pana chahida. - Do not meddle in others' affairs.
      These proverbs push individuals to reflect on their actions and decisions, serving as a compass for ethical living.

      Learning a few Punjabi proverbs can significantly enhance your understanding of Punjabi culture and language subleties.

      Examples of Punjabi Proverbs and Sayings

      Punjabi proverbs and sayings are an integral part of the culture, providing wisdom and guidance through life’s complexities. These proverbs are not just words; they are lessons that embody the values and experiences of Punjabi society.The use of these proverbs spans various aspects of life, from personal growth to social conduct, delivering timeless wisdom in a few concise words.

      • Mithe bolo, sab gal nuhal jave. - Sweet words can solve all problems, emphasizing the power of kindness.
      • Pehla tarki te phir kammi. - Progress comes before profit, stressing the importance of patience and effort.
      • Vela khoon diyan haaneri galiyaan. - Time's lost no one can regain, highlighting the value of time.

      Punjabi Proverb: A short, wise saying in Punjabi language that conveys practical life lessons and cultural beliefs.

      Roles and Functions of Punjabi Proverbs

      Punjabi proverbs fulfill multiple roles in the community, serving as a tool for education, communication, and cultural preservation. These proverbs:

      • Convey cultural values and traditions.
      • Encourage critical thinking and reflection.
      • Serve as a bridge between generations, preserving linguistic heritage.
      Understanding these roles can help you appreciate the depth and utility of Punjabi proverbs in everyday life.

      The historical context of Punjabi proverbs often stems from the region's agricultural roots. Many sayings reflect themes of hard work, nature, and patience, illustrating a culture deeply connected to its environment. For example, the proverb Chardi kala vich rehna, meaning to stay in perpetual optimism, is drawn from centuries of resilience against challenges, mirroring the tenacity required for farming. This illustrates how proverbs can reflect broader socio-economic conditions and communal mentality of a culture. Examining these backgrounds gives profound insights into not only linguistics but the history and mindset of Punjabi people.
